Canada’s armed forces are currently engaged in a large-scale training exercise in the country’s Arctic north. Over 40% of Canadian territory lies above the Arctic Circle—an area gaining strategic geopolitical significance as climate change transforms the once-frozen landscape. As tensions rise over the region’s vast natural resources, particularly with rivals like Russia and China, Western militaries are under growing pressure to strengthen their capabilities.
